The US stock market is a complex and dynamic system, with thousands of publicly traded companies listed on various exchanges. To navigate this market, it’s essential to understand the different types of stocks, including common stocks, preferred stocks, and growth stocks. Common stocks represent ownership in a company and give shareholders the right to receive a portion of the company’s profits. Preferred stocks, on the other hand, have a higher claim on assets and dividends than common stocks. Growth stocks, as the name suggests, are stocks that have the potential for high growth rates and are often associated with companies that are expanding rapidly.

Key Concepts for Investing in Stocks in the US

Before investing in stocks in the US, it’s essential to understand some key concepts, including:

  • Stocks: Also known as equities, stocks represent ownership in a company and give shareholders the right to receive a portion of the company’s profits.
  • Bull Market: A bull market is a prolonged period of time when the stock market is rising, with prices increasing and investor sentiment being positive.
  • Bear Market: A bear market is a prolonged period of time when the stock market is falling, with prices decreasing and investor sentiment being negative.
  • Portfolio: A portfolio is a collection of investments, including stocks, bonds, and other securities, that an investor holds to achieve their financial goals.

It’s also essential to understand the different types of stock market orders, including market orders, limit orders, and stop-loss orders. Market orders are executed at the current market price, while limit orders are executed at a specified price or better. Stop-loss orders, on the other hand, are used to limit potential losses by selling a stock when it falls to a certain price.

Risks Associated with Investing in Stocks in the US

While investing in stocks in the US can be a rewarding experience, it’s essential to understand the risks associated with this type of investing. Some of the key risks include:

  • Market Volatility: The stock market can be highly volatile, with prices fluctuating rapidly in response to changing market conditions.
  • Company-Specific Risks: Companies can experience financial difficulties, management changes, or other issues that can negatively impact their stock price.
  • Economic Risks: Economic downturns, recessions, or other economic events can negatively impact the stock market and the companies listed on it.

To mitigate these risks, it’s essential to develop a well-diversified portfolio, conduct thorough research, and set clear financial goals. It’s also essential to understand the different types of risk, including market risk, company-specific risk, and economic risk.
